Of the 101 genome-wide associated SNPs examined, male-only associations of alpha EEG coherence with rs59979824 (an intergenic variant on chromosome 2) and rs11740474 (GALNT10 variant on chromosome 5) withstood a multiple test correction (Fig. 3, Supplemental Fig. 3, and Supplemental Table 1); Fig. 3 displays the association of rs59979824 (panel A) and rs11740474 (panel B) with high-alpha EEG coherence in males from ages 12–32. Associations of rs59979824 with high-alpha EEG coherence were observed across several fronto-central electrode pairs, with effects peaking between ages 14–24. In contrast, the majority of associations observed between rs11740474 and fronto-central high-alpha coherence occurred between ages 25–31.
